Young WA leaders appointed ahead of 18s championships Print E-mail

Following a player-driven voting process, Subiaco midfielder Daniel Rich has been named as captain of the WA State 18s side ahead of the team’s 2008 NAB National 18s Championship campaign.

Athletic ruckman Nicholas Naitanui and Matt DeBoer have been appointed the team’s two vice captains. All three of these players were involved in the successful 2007 team and were voted unanimously by their peers as the players to lead the team into the 2008 championships.

The process for the selection of the leadership group was driven by the players and the coaching staff was excited by the players chosen.

“All of the boys selected display some excellent leadership traits. We sometimes forget that they are still only 18 years old and for young men of that age, they really do conduct themselves in an outstanding fashion,” said Jon Haines, the West Australian Football Commission’s Talent and Coaching Manager.

“Not only are these three young men outstanding footballers, but they are tremendous citizens, all with their own set of individual characteristics. They are a credit to their families and their football clubs and we have no doubt that they will represent WA with pride and integrity.”

The WA State 18’s complete their preparation for their Round 1 NAB National 18s Championship game on Sunday, June 1 with a final practice game tomorrow (May 24) against the West Australian Country Football League State side at Fremantle Oval. The final squad will then be announced at the WA State 18s jumper presentation on Monday May 26th at Subiaco Oval.

State 18s current squad

Claremont  -- Tom Swift, Dylan Ross, Matt DeBoer, James Klause, Jess Laurie
East Fremantle -- James Bayliss, Kane Lucas, Nicholas Olds, Brad Sheppard
East Perth -- Mitchell Duncan, Daniel Murray, Hamish Shepheard
Peel -- Johnny Bennell, Anthony Morabito, Chris Luff
Perth -- Blake Warner, Rhys Peedle, Alistair Smith, Kane Goodwin, Joel Fiegert, Michael Mather
South Fremantle -- Mitch Marsh
Subiaco -- Daniel Rich
Swan Districts -- Clint Garlett, Neville Jetta, Nicholas Naitanui, Clancee Pearce, Michael Walters, Chris Yarran, Lance Daly
West Perth -- Stephen Hill


WA State 18s NAB Championship fixtures

Sunday 1st June WA vs NSW/ACTSubiaco Oval11.30am 
Sunday 8th JuneWA v SA  AAMI1.00pm
Saturday 21st JuneWA v Vic Country Subiaco Oval 2.30pm
Saturday 5th JulyWA v TasmaniaMCG 10.00am
Wednesday 9th JulyWA v Vic MetroTelstra Dome 2.30pm
